Subject: [PATCH 0/3] ACPI / Battery: fix NULL pointer dereference from battery

The following oops happens non-deterministically when resuming from suspend on
a recent Acer Aspire laptop.  The issue seems to be unregistering a led trigger
that was never registered.  The led_trigger->next_trig list_head fields contain
zeroes, hence the NULL pointer dereference in list_del().

Due to the non-deterministic nature of the bug I am not sure whether the
patches eliminate the oops.  However, the patches do address real problems in
drivers/acpi/battery.c.

There is a lack of error handling in battery.c so when power_supply_register()
fails the power_supply will continue be used as if there was no error.  The
reason for this is that power_supply_register() leaves a stale
power_supply->dev pointer set when it returns an error and battery.c simply
uses that field to decide whether the power_supply is registered or not.  This
is fixed in the first patch.

The second and third patches clean up the error handling in acpi_battery_add()
to prevent a use-after-free and properly release resources.

Stefan Hajnoczi (3):
  power_supply: scrub device pointer if registration fails
  ACPI / Battery: avoid acpi_battery_add() use-after-free
  ACPI / Battery: propagate sysfs error in acpi_battery_add()
